if you dont do snow the only purpose of 4x4 would be getting stuck in mud/dirt. If you get a dumpbody put on it and some weight in the back, you should be good. I plowed with a f350 mason dump and never used 4x4. The trucks are so heavy that its not needed.
Who cares about the options. Whats the axles look like? Trans shift? Frame rot? You have to think expensive repairs.
